Sennheiser
The friendly giant of headphone manufacturers, Germany's Sennheiser has it dialed in. Not only do they own super-advanced audio research equipment, they also have pristine ears. The seamless HD650 headphone is the proof.
Shure
Shure has been around forever making phono cartridges & pro-audio microphones. This Chicago-based manufacturer also has a forceful presence in the earphone market and their current-generation SE310 and SE530 models are superb.
AKG
This Austrian audio powerhouse makes lots of pro musician products, but also makes headsets for hands-free cell phone use -- among a million other things. Their K-701 audiophile headphone is amazing!
Grado
This small family-operated Brooklyn-based audio manufacturer became famous making high-end turntable cartridges. It may look a tad old-school, but their SR-60 is likely the best sub-$100 headphone.
Denon
Denon manufactures many very fine audio products & also happens to make some of the best sealed headphones in the world.
beyerdynamic
This venerable German company has been making headphones & microphones for the pro audio world since the dawn of electricity. They’re renown for great sealed cans, but also make some world-class open headphones, the DT880 & DT990.
Etymotic Research
Originators in scientific instrumentation for measuring ear response in the hearing aid & earphone industry, Etymotic was first to market ear canal headphones.
Jays
One of the latest companies added to HeadRoom's repertoire. This headphone manufacturer out of Sweden specializes in well-priced ear canal headphones.
Yuin
Yuin is a new earbud manufacturer based out of China, and making a splash with high quality ear-bud headphones.
Ultimate Ears
California-based manufacturer renown for the world’s finest ear canal headphone, the audiologist-customized UE10Pro. UE also has a full line of killer 'universal-fit' Super.Fi earphones that look amazing & sound great.
Koss
King of inexpensive headphones, Koss makes a LOT of cans, some amazingly great for the price. The PortaPro is still one of the best sub-$50 headphones around!
Ultrasone
The new German kids on the block, Ultrasone has been working very hard to kick their latest line into high gear. Their HFI-700 is hard to beat for a top-shelf 'sealed' headphone.
